In this episode of Trust Issues, sponsored by Baillie Gifford, we speak with Svetlana Viteva, co-manager of Edinburgh Worldwide (EWI), about the trust's investment strategy, some of the exciting, enduring themes in which it invests, such as quantum computing, and the upcoming vote on resolutions put forward by US hedge fund Saba Capital Management.
